Android Studio jest jednym z najpopularniejszych środowisk programistycznych do tworzenia aplikacji mobilnych dla systemu Android. Jedną z najważniejszych funkcji, które oferuje to narzędzie, jest możliwość pobierania danych z różnych źródeł, w tym z interfejsów programowania aplikacji (API). Dzięki temu programiści mogą wykorzystać bogate zasoby informacji dostępne w sieci do tworzenia funkcjonalnych i interaktywnych aplikacji. W tym wprowadzeniu omówimy, jak korzystać z Android Studio do pobierania danych z API i wykorzystywać je w naszych projektach.
Jak pobierać dane z API w aplikacjach mobilnych napisanych w Android Studio?
Aby pobierać dane z API w aplikacjach mobilnych napisanych w Android Studio, należy wykonać następujące kroki:
1. Utwórz nowy projekt w Android Studio lub otwórz istniejący.
2. W pliku manifestu dodaj uprawnienia do korzystania z internetu.
3. W pliku build.gradle dodaj bibliotekę do obsługi żądań HTTP, na przykład Retrofit lub Volley.
4. Utwórz interfejs, który będzie zawierał metody do pobierania danych z API.
5. Zaimplementuj logikę pobierania danych w odpowiedniej aktywności lub fragmencie.
6. Wywołaj odpowiednią metodę z interfejsu i przekaż jej adres URL oraz parametry żądania.
7. Przetwórz otrzymane dane i wyświetl je w aplikacji.
Pamiętaj, że przed pobraniem danych należy sprawdzić dostępność połączenia internetowego oraz obsłużyć ewentualne błędy podczas pobierania danych.
Wykorzystanie biblioteki Retrofit do pobierania danych z API w Android Studio
Biblioteka Retrofit jest wykorzystywana w Android Studio do pobierania danych z API. Jest to narzędzie, które ułatwia komunikację z serwerem i przetwarzanie otrzymanych informacji. Dzięki temu można szybko i łatwo pobrać potrzebne dane do aplikacji mobilnej. Retrofit jest często wybieranym rozwiązaniem ze względu na swoją prostotę i wydajność.
Praktyczne przykłady wykorzystania Volley do pobierania danych z API w aplikacjach na Androida
Volley jest biblioteką do obsługi sieci w aplikacjach na Androida. Pozwala na łatwe i wydajne pobieranie danych z API, czyli interfejsu programistycznego aplikacji.
Przykładowe zastosowania Volley w aplikacjach na Androida to pobieranie listy produktów z serwera internetowego w celu wyświetlenia ich w sklepie internetowym, pobieranie aktualności z serwisu informacyjnego do aplikacji czy też pobieranie danych użytkownika z serwera do profilu w aplikacji społecznościowej.
Dzięki wykorzystaniu Volley, programiści mogą uniknąć pisania skomplikowanego kodu obsługującego połączenie z serwerem i przetwarzanie odpowiedzi. Biblioteka ta oferuje wiele funkcji ułatwiających pracę z siecią, takich jak automatyczne zarządzanie kolejnością żądań, pamięci podręcznej czy obsługa błędów.
W praktyce, aby skorzystać z Volley w swojej aplikacji, należy dodać odpowiednie zależności do pliku Gradle oraz utworzyć obiekt RequestQueue, który będzie zarządzał kolejnymi żądaniami. Następnie należy utworzyć obiekt Request i dodać go do kolejki. Po otrzymaniu odpowiedzi od serwera, można przetworzyć dane i wyświetlić je w aplikacji.
Volley jest często wybieranym narzędziem do obsługi sieci w aplikacjach na Androida ze względu na swoją prostotę i wydajność. Dzięki niemu pobieranie danych z API staje się szybkie i nie wymaga dużego nakładu pracy programisty.
Android Studio jest bardzo przydatnym narzędziem dla programistów, którzy chcą pobierać dane z API. Dzięki wykorzystaniu różnych bibliotek i narzędzi, możliwe jest łatwe i szybkie pobieranie danych z różnych źródeł. Wymaga to jednak odpowiedniej wiedzy i umiejętności programistycznych. Warto również pamiętać o bezpieczeństwie i prawidłowym zarządzaniu danymi pobranymi z API. Dzięki Android Studio możliwe jest tworzenie wydajnych i funkcjonalnych aplikacji, które korzystają z danych zewnętrznych źródeł. Warto więc poświęcić czas na naukę korzystania z tego narzędzia, aby móc wykorzystać jego pełny potencjał w tworzeniu aplikacji mobilnych.
0 thoughts on “Android Studio: Pobierz dane z API”